Experiment Title | Assessment of natural parasitization of mango fruit borer, Citripestis eutraphera (Meyrick), (Lepidoptera:Pyralidae) | ||
Research Type | Departmental Research | ||
Experiment Background | Mango is attacked by more than 400 pests in the world (Tandon and Verghese, 1985). Several fruit borer species of mango is identified so far in different mango orchards in India. The mango fruit borer, Citripestis eutraphera (Meyrick), (Lepidoptera:Pyralidae) originally confined to the Andaman Islands, is a recent invasion in mainland India. C. eutraphera which was originally described from Java, is a significant borer of mango fruits in South and South-East Asia and some parts of Australia (Anderson and Tran-Nguyen, 2012). The most recent classical example of intra-national invasion of insect pests from the Andaman and Nicobar Islands to mainland India is the mango fruit borer, C. eutraphera (Jayanthi et al., 2014). They first time reported the occurrence of C. eutraphera causing extensive damage to immature fruits of mango in Karnataka and Tamil Nadu. Recently, infestation of C. eutraphera was reported first time causing extensive damage in Gujarat (Bana et al., 2018). Mango-growing pockets in the southwestern parts of Gujarat, as well as parts of Kerala and Tamil Nadu were moderately to highly suitable for C. eutraphera distribution in 2050 and 2070 (Choudhary et al., 2019). Mango fruit borer has become a serious problem in major mango growing areas of Gujarat and peak infestation of this pest occurs during April-May, which approximately coincides with ‘marble stage’ of fruit development. But, research data on natural enemies of C. eutraphera was lacking. By considering this, the present study will be carried out to know the status of natural parasitization of mango fruit borer in South Gujarat. | ||
